Putting the 'P' back in M&P

Over the years, aerospace composites trade events have been quite popular and usually attract a loyal following of people involved in this industry. Most of us in the industry look forward each year to attending at least one composites conference. But at the core of these events is an imbalance that I think needs to be corrected. Historically, the technical papers and presentations at aerospace conferences have focused heavily on materials. How composite parts are built is often just an afterthought. At the recent Society for the Advancement of Materials and Process Engineering (SAMPE) 2007 Technical Conference, for example, a huge majority of papers listed in the program focused on materials (properties, testing, etc). As I reviewed the program, 1 wondered, Where are the processing papers? This heavy emphasis on materials comes at a time when the aerospace industry is dramatically increasing the amount of composite structure on aerospace vehicles (especially commercial aircraft). The increase in composite materials used in airframes means that a greater volume of composite parts are being built today than ever before. You would think that the manufacturing processes used to build these parts would get more attention at the industry's premier events.
